Solutions for "unfamiliar crossword clue" by Letter Count
3 Letters
NEW: Often used for something recently encountered or not previously known.
ODD: Can imply something strange or unusual, hence unfamiliar.
5 Letters
NOVEL: Refers to something fresh, original, or unusual, suggesting unfamiliarity.
ALIEN: Implies something strange, foreign, or disturbing, thus unfamiliar.
7 Letters
UNKNOWN: A direct synonym for not known or identified, perfectly fitting unfamiliar.
STRANGE: Means unusual or surprising in a way that is unsettling or hard to understand.
8 Letters
ESOTERIC: Describes something understood by only a small, specialized group, implying general unfamiliarity.
More About "unfamiliar crossword clue"
The clue "unfamiliar" in crosswords is a versatile one, often pointing to answers that signify newness, uniqueness, or a lack of prior knowledge. Crossword setters love to play with synonyms and concepts around this word. While straightforward answers like UNKNOWN are common, you might also encounter more nuanced terms like NOVEL (for something creatively new) or ESOTERIC (for knowledge not widely known).
When you see "unfamiliar," consider the context of the puzzle. Is it looking for a general synonym, or a more specific type of unfamiliarity? Pay close attention to the number of letters required and any intersecting letters you might already have filled in. This can often narrow down the possibilities significantly.
Remember that crosswords often use common words in slightly uncommon ways, so an answer that seems simple might be the correct fit for a clue like "unfamiliar" when paired with the right letter count.
